Quality Carriers, Inc. (QC), headquartered in Tampa, FL, is North America's largest bulk liquid chemical carrier. Through a network of more than 100 terminals and facilities, we transport a broad range of chemical products and provide our customers with value-added transportation services.
Quality Repair Solutions (QRS Shops), a fully-owned division of Quality Carriers, Inc., specializes in comprehensive tractor and trailer maintenance.
